Maison  >  Article  >  Java  >  En Java, comment convertir une liste en tableau JSON ?

En Java, comment convertir une liste en tableau JSON ?

WBOY
WBOYavant
2023-09-20 13:29:091263parcourir

En Java, comment convertir une liste en tableau JSON ?

JSON est un format d'échange de données léger, basé sur du texte et indépendant de la langue. JSON peut représenter deux types structurés, tels que object et array. Un objet est une collection non ordonnée de paires clé/valeur , et un tableau est une séquence ordonnée de valeurs.

Nous pouvons convertir la liste en tableau JSON en utilisant la méthode JSONArray.toJSONString(), qui est une méthode static JSONArray, qui convertit la liste en texte JSON, et le résultat est un Tableau JSON .

Syntaxe
public static java.lang.String toJSONString(java.util.List list)

Exemple

import java.util.*;
import org.json.simple.*;
public class ConvertListToJSONArrayTest {
   public static void main(String[] args) {
      List<String> list = new ArrayList<String>();
      list.add("India");
      list.add("Australia");
      list.add("England");
      list.add("South Africa");
      list.add("West Indies");
      list.add("Newzealand");
<strong>     </strong> // this method converts a list to JSON Array
      String jsonStr = JSONArray.toJSONString(list);
      System.out.println(jsonStr);
   }
}

Sortie

["India","Australia","England","South Africa","West Indies","Newzealand"]

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Cet article est reproduit dans:. en cas de violation, veuillez contacter admin@php.cn Supprimer